Description:

For First Responder courses. The most comprehensive first responder book/multimedia package available. Featuring an easy-to-read, step-by-step format that has made the text a student favorite for over a decade, it goes well beyond the national standards set by the U.S. government to fully cover the D.O.T. Curriculum, offers expanded coverage of common medical emergencies not covered in the D.O.T. curriculum, and includes a variety of enrichment materials.
